> Building the test suite for C (GLib) yields this warning from the compiler:
> {code}
> gen-c_glib/t_test_empty_service.c:176:1: warning:
> ‘t_test_empty_service_processor_process_function_defs’ defined but not used
> [-Wunused-variable]
> t_test_empty_service_processor_process_function_defs[0] = {
> {code}
> The compiler should not generate a processing-function-definition array for a
> service with no methods, considering it is smart enough in this case not to
> generate the code that would use it.
